480 Improving Safety for Incarcerated Transgender Women*
Description

As the political situation worsens for incarcerated transgender women and transgender individuals generally, new models to safely house and care for them are needed. Transgender women are at imminent risk for physical and sexual violence in correctional settings, and corrections has encountered difficulties in meeting their basic needs. While corrections principles focus on being firm, fair, and consistent, flexibility and equity frameworks are needed. This workshop will address various models and systemic issues for housing and caring for transgender women. 

Educational Objectives

  • Identify current challenges that impact transgender women's health and housing
  • Describe models of care that can keep transgender women safer and healthier
  • Review health care, housing, and safety issues for transgender women
